Windows文件名的最大长度取决于文件系统类型:
FAT32: 8个字符的文件名和3个字符的扩展名,共11个字符。这是最老的文件系统类型,现在很少使用。 NTFS: 255个字符,包括文件名和扩展名。这是Windows系统中最常用的文件系统类型。 ReFS: 255个字符,包括文件名和扩展名。这是Windows 10和Windows 11中引入的新文件系统类型。
请注意,文件路径的总长度(包括驱动器名、文件夹名和文件名)也有限制。例如,在NTFS和ReFS文件系统中,文件路径的总长度不能超过32,767个字符。
此外,Windows文件名有一些特殊的规则:
文件名不能包含以下字符: / : ? | 文件名不能以空格或点 开头。 文件名不能与同一文件夹中的其他文件同名。
Windows文件名长度的限制与突破
在Windows操作系统中,文件名的长度一直是用户关注的焦点之一。正确的文件命名不仅有助于文件的管理,还能避免在文件操作过程中遇到不必要的麻烦。本文将详细介绍Windows文件名的长度限制、命名规则以及如何突破这些限制。
在未启用长路径支持的情况下,Windows文件名的最大长度为255个字符。这意味着,包括文件名和扩展名在内,文件名的长度不能超过255个字符。例如,一个名为“example.txt”的文件,其文件名长度为8个字符,扩展名长度为4个字符,总共12个字符,符合长度限制。
Windows文件名的命名规则相对简单,但也有一些需要注意的细节:
文件名可以包含除以下符号之外的字符:?\